AGD started producing the "Classic" model which comes with no barrel or air conections and only one star (all this makes the 'mag cheaper). They did this b/c people tend to replace those stock parts in favor of their own setup. The reason for the single star instead of three is so AGD could offer the same quality product at a cheaper price (you don't have to pay for as much service with the Classic).
I believe you can still buy the three star valve, but it says 68AutoMag and comes with a barrel and bottomline.
